Embattled Director of Radio Biafra and Leader of the Indigenous People of Biafra, IPOB, Nnamdi Kanu, was finally arraigned on Monday, in an Abuja Magistrate Court.
Immediately Kanu was brought in by the SSS there was jubilation by the people outside, chanting: “Nwa Chineke” meaning child of God.
Most of them were running to touch the accused person as Kanu, looking scruffy, unkempt and dressed in a light blue shirt waved to the crowd.
Kanu was arrested on October 18 by operatives of the State Security Services (SSS) on his arrival from the United Kingdom.On November 18, Kanu’s arraignment was stalled due to absence in court.
The magistrate had ordered the SSS to produce Kanu in court on the next adjourned date – today, November 23.
There was heavy security presence in an Abuja magistrate court following the arraignment of Mr

Kanu.The security operatives mostly armed search asked anyone who tried to enter the court for identification.
